  • Are infertility and sterility the same?
    No, infertility and sterility are not the same:
    • Infertility refers to the inability to conceive after a year of regular, unprotected sex. It can be temporary or treatable, and sometimes people can still conceive with treatment or assistive reproductive methods.

    • Sterility is a permanent inability to conceive or father children, often due to irreversible conditions like damage to reproductive organs or genetic disorders.

    Infertility is often reversible, while sterility is not.

  • Where does infertility come from?

    Infertility can stem from various sources, affecting either partner. Common causes include:

    • In women:

      • Ovulation disorders (e.g., PCOS, hormonal imbalances)
      • Blocked fallopian tubes (due to infections, endometriosis, or surgery)
      • Uterine conditions (e.g., fibroids, polyps)
      • Age-related decline in egg quality and quantity
      • Poor egg health
    • In men:

      • Low sperm count or poor sperm quality (motility, shape)
      • Blocked sperm ducts
      • Hormonal imbalances
      • Varicocele (enlarged veins in the scrotum)
      • Genetic conditions
    • Other factors:

      • Lifestyle choices (e.g., smoking, excessive alcohol use, obesity)
      • Environmental toxins or radiation exposure
      • Stress or psychological factors

    Sometimes, infertility may have no clear cause. A fertility specialist can help identify the underlying issue.

  • How infertility occurs in male?

    Infertility in males can occur due to several factors:

    • Low sperm count or poor sperm quality (motility, shape)
    • Blocked sperm ducts or issues with sperm transport
    • Hormonal imbalances affecting sperm production
    • Varicocele (enlarged veins in the scrotum)
    • Erectile dysfunction or premature ejaculation
    • Genetic conditions like Klinefelter syndrome
    • Infections affecting the reproductive system
    • Lifestyle factors (smoking, alcohol, drug use, obesity)
    • Exposure to toxins or high heat (e.g., from certain occupations or tight clothing)

    Testing and diagnosis by a fertility specialist can help determine the cause.

  • Can infertility be cured?

    Infertility can often be treated, but whether it can be fully “cured” depends on the underlying cause. Many fertility issues can be addressed with treatments like medications, surgery, or assisted reproductive technologies (e.g., IVF). However, in some cases, such as with advanced age or certain genetic conditions, achieving pregnancy may not be possible. A fertility specialist can help determine the best course of action based on individual circumstances.
